What is Acute Myeloid Leukemia?

Intense myeloid leukemia is a type of cancer that affects the myeloid cells in the bone marrow. Myeloid cells are accountable for producing red cell, leukocyte, and platelets. In AML, the myeloid cells become irregular and begin to grow and multiply uncontrollably, causing a buildup of malignant cells in the bone marrow and blood.

Reasons For Acute Myeloid Leukemia

AML can be triggered by a variety of factors, including:

  • Genetic anomalies: Some individuals may be born with genetic anomalies that increase their threat of establishing AML.
  • Direct toxic exposure laws to hazardous chemicals: Exposure to chemicals such as benzene, formaldehyde, and pesticides has been linked to an increased risk of developing AML.
  • Radiation direct exposure: Exposure to high levels of radiation, such as from nuclear mishaps or medical treatments, can increase the threat of developing AML.
  • Previous cancer treatment: Some cancer treatments, such as chemotherapy and radiation treatment, can increase the threat of establishing AML.

Railroad Work and Acute Myeloid Leukemia

Railroad workers are at danger of developing AML due to their exposure to hazardous chemicals and substances on the task. Some of the chemicals and substances that railroad workers might be exposed to consist of:

  • Benzene: Benzene Exposure Risks is a known carcinogen that is frequently utilized in the railroad market as a solvent and degreaser.
  • Diesel fuel: Diesel fuel is a recognized carcinogen that is utilized to power locomotives and other equipment in the railroad market.
  • asbestos exposure: Asbestos is a known workplace carcinogen exposure that was frequently used in the railroad industry for insulation and other purposes.
  • Pesticides and herbicides: Railroad workers might be exposed to pesticides and herbicides, which are used to control weeds and other plant life along railroad tracks.
